Two Saigonees die because of holes in the road
Published: 12/10/2010 05:00
| At least two people, one man and one woman, died last week in HCM City because of holes in the road.
A man who was riding a bicycle in downpour fell on a culvert and died of suffocation on To Ngoc Van road, Thu Duc District on the afternoon of October 10.
The downpour flooded the area so the man couldn’t see the culvert. Many people saw the accident and tried to help the man but he was swept away by the water. After over 30 minutes, people found his body and his bicycle stuck in the middle of the culvert.
One day ago, on October 9, a woman who was carrying her son on a motorbike died after she hit a hole on Kha Van Can road, also in Thu Duc district, fell on the road and was ran over by a truck.
Her son fell onto the other side thus luckily escaping death.
Many local people complained to VietNamNet that whenever it rains, many culverts on the road have become “traps”. They voluntarily pitched warning plates at such sites but couldn’t cover all because there are so many holes.
